Although theres no one right age for a girl to get her period, there are some clues that it will start soon. Typically, a girl gets her period about 2 years after her breasts start to develop. Another sign is vaginal discharge fluid (sort of like mucus) that a girl might see or feel on her underwear.
When do most girls get their period? Most girls get their first period when theyre between 10 and 15 years old. The average age is 12, but every girls body has its own schedule. Although theres no one right age for a girl to get her period, there are some clues that it will start soon.
Most girls get their first period when theyre around 12. But getting it any time between age 10 and 15 is OK.
Scotland is the first country to offer period products free of charge on a national scale. Others, including New Zealand and Kenya, distribute products for free in public schools. In the U.S., a package of tampons or menstrual pads costs around $7 to $10 for a supply that may last a month or two.
